comp.lang.idl-pvwave archive
Messages from Usenet group comp.lang.idl-pvwave, compiled by Paulo Penteado

Home » Public Forums » archive » Re: What are the errors in the FFT?
Show: Today's Messages :: Show Polls :: Message Navigator
E-mail to friend 
Return to the default flat view Create a new topic Submit Reply
Re: What are the errors in the FFT? [message #52458 is a reply to message #52441] Thu, 08 February 2007 10:37 Go to previous messageGo to previous message
Haje Korth is currently offline  Haje Korth
Messages: 651
Registered: May 1997
Senior Member
Monty,
Congratulations, you have just discovered you machine's precisions in doing
floating point mathematics. :-)

BTW: I have uploaded an FFTW3 implementation to the ITTVIS codebank. Should
be ready for grabs there in a few days. You can double check just for grins.

Cheers,
Haje



<monty@lanl.gov> wrote in message
news:1170953635.505681.59040@v33g2000cwv.googlegroups.com...
> For a given function f(t) I am finding:
>
> FFT(FFT(f(t),-1),1) -f(t) varies between about 10^-7 to 1-^-8 for
> floating point
> and about 10^-14 to 10^-16 for double precision
>
> (I.e. the inverse transform of the transform deviates from the
> original function)
>
> Is this aproblem with the IDL implementation of the FFT, or is this a
> more fundamental issue with the algorithm itself?
>
> -Monty Wood
>
[Message index]
 
Read Message
Read Message
Read Message
Read Message
Read Message
Previous Topic: Arrays of Structures
Next Topic: Re: READS as a speed improvement or simply style?

-=] Back to Top [=-
[ Syndicate this forum (XML) ] [ RSS ] [ PDF ]

Current Time: Fri Oct 10 10:00:53 PDT 2025

Total time taken to generate the page: 0.95705 seconds